A person messaged me via a comment on my personal blog that they navigated to from my signature saying they were selling a GPS 175 that I expressed interest in in a thread posted by someone on the classifieds -
this thread. The email address they provided in the comment on my blog was "maritimesend@gmail.com".
After a quick back and forth via email, they offered a 50% deposit and 50% after receiving the item. They then proceeded to provide me Zelle information with a completely different email and name: Brandon Olin , "brandonolin336@gmail.com".
I then decided to message the original poster of the thread above via a PM to confirm the information was all correct. There was no response from the emailer via PM at the time of the conversation. I then asked if there was a phone number that I could FaceTime or see pictures of the GPS. They provided me a number that was a google voice number (anyone can make one for free). I proceeded to speak to the person on the phone, and when I asked for them to say the name of the original poster, the line cut off.
I did a quick google search for that email address: maritimesend... and half a dozen results came up with "potential scammer" for difference sites including VAF from 2021 (with a different username) , as well as a gun site, and a boat site.
I don't think the OP of the above thread is the scammer, but I think the scammer is impersonating him.
